The New Definition of Success

Work-life balance isn’t just a buzzword—it’s a strategic imperative. It means having the energy, clarity, and emotional bandwidth to thrive both professionally and personally. It’s not about splitting time evenly between work and home, but about integrating your priorities in a way that feels authentic and sustainable.

When your career aligns with your core values, work becomes more than a paycheck—it becomes a source of meaning. You feel energized rather than depleted. You’re able to show up fully for your team, your family, and yourself. That’s the kind of success that lasts.

What Fulfillment Looks Like

Professionals who achieve true balance and fulfillment share a few key traits:

  • Stress Management : They know how to regulate their energy and emotions, even in high-pressure environments.
  • Healthy Boundaries : They protect their time and attention, saying “no” when necessary and “yes” with intention.
  • Value Alignment : Their work reflects what they care about most—whether it’s innovation, impact, creativity, or connection.
  • Sustainable Habits : They build routines that support both performance and well-being, from morning rituals to digital detoxes.
